Opinion

Broyles, P. J.

This was the first grant of a new trial, and it will not be disturbed, as it does not appear that the judge abused hi's discretion in granting it, and that the facts and the law required the verdict notwithstanding his judgment. Civil Code (1910), § 6204.

Judgment affirmed.

Jenkins and Bloodworth, JJ., concur. Foreclosure of mortgage; from city court of Zabulón.—Judge Dupree'. January 5, 1916. • Bedding <& Lester, for plaintiff in error. J. M. Smith, contra.
